1. Check this year's file for cohesiveness between Year 9 and Year 11
Note that:
- Open you current year's .etz file (perhaps take a copy of the file first to perform the following if unsure)
- Go to Master Grid (F11)
- Double click on Yr11 to sort by line
- Locate the Year 9 lines and see whether the line numbers match the Year 11 line numbers.
If they do match, proceed to the next step. - If they do not match, take note of how they do line up (eg take a screenshot or note on paper). If a Year 9 line works under several Year 11 lines, take note of the line the classes mostly sit under and use that one.
- Go to Class data > Yr9
- Sort by Line column
- Enter the newly decided Line numbers into the Line fields.
- Return to the Master grid to check the line numbers now match
- Open the next year's .etz file
- Go to Class data > Yr10
- Sort by Line column
- Enter the correct Line numbers into the Line fields (Year 10 class line numbers should now should match the line entries you put into Year 9 above).
Line entries in Class data must be numbered lines (Line 1, Line 2 etc), not letter lines (Line A, Line B etc) to be referenced correctly to use the 'Timetable around' feature.
2. Create a combined year level (Yr10+12)
- Go to Setup > Year levels
- Enter 10+12 into the bottom empty cell
Tip: No need to enter the text 'Yr', it will be added that for you.
3. Edit the Year 11 line parameters
- Go to Lines > Elective data > Courses
- Select the Year 11 dataset from the Filter dropdown
- From the Action bar, select Parameters
- In the 'Timetable around yr' field, select the combined Yr10+12
4. Generate Year 11 lines
The 'Timetable around' feature reads the Class data screen, specifically the Line column. It also will check the Assigned staff and Assigned room columns for any hard coded staffing and rooming.
